Harke Park
Harke Park is a park in Lebanon Township, Laclede, Missouri. Harke Park is situated nearby to Nelson Park, as well as near Liberty Cemetery.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Floyd W. Jones Lebanon Airport
Aerodrome
Floyd W. Jones Lebanon Airport is a city-owned public-use airport located three nautical miles south of the central business district of Lebanon, a city in Laclede County, Missouri, United States.

Lebanon
Photo: KLOTZ,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Lebanon is a city of 15,000 people in Central Missouri on the historic Route 66. It is a good base for exploring Bennett Spring State Park. As the home of several factories, it has been dubbed the "Aluminum Fishing Boat Capital of the World", a claim that has not been challenged by any other town.
